Skip to main content
HomeAboutServicesAppointmentsBlog
AdCrafters
AdCrafters
HomeAboutServicesAppointmentsBlog
AdCrafters
HomeAboutServicesAppointmentsBlog
AdCrafters
HomeAboutServicesAppointmentsBlog

This website uses cookies to analyze website traffic and optimize your experience. By accepting, your data will be aggregated with all other user data.